République Algérienne Démocratique et Populaire Ministère de l’enseignement Sup
République Algérienne Démocratique et Populaire Ministère de l’enseignement Supérieur et de la recherche Scientifique Université ABBES LAGHROUR _ KHENCHELA 3éme Année informatique solution de devoir: Données Semi_Struct Réalisé par: Ahmed Bouzaher Encadrer par : chouhal ouahiba 2020/2021 1 EX01 : Q1 : CV en XML < ?xml version= "1 .0" encoding ="UTF-8" ?> <cvxmlns= "utc.fr/nf29 /crozatst/schéma/cv " > <en tète> <nom>Bouzaher</nom> <Prénom>Ahmed</prénom> <ddn>14/09/1999</ddn> <nationalité>Algérienne</nationalité> <situation maritale>Célibataire</situation maritale> <permis>B</permis> <email> ahmedbouzaher21@gmail.com > </en tète> <situation actuelle>Etudiant en troisième année de informatique a l’université khenchela </situation actuelle> <diplomes> 2 <diplôme> <année>2018</année> <intitule>Baccalauréat scientifique</intitule> </diplôme> <diplôme> <année>2014</année> <intitule>Brevet des collèges</intitule> </diplôme> </diplomes> <langue> <intitule>Anglais</intitule> <niveau>Bilingue</niveau> </langue> <langues> <intitule>Français</intitule> <niveau>Rudiments</niveau> </langue> <langues> 3 <loisirs> <loisir>Sports</loisir> <loisir>Cinéma</loisir> <loisir>Lecture</loisir> </loisirs> </CV > Q2 : en DTD < !ELEMENT cv (nom, prénom, email, rubrique ,langues ,loisir+, stages, age ?) > < !ELEMENT nom(#PCDATA)> < !ELEMENT prénom(#PCDATA)> < !ELEMENT age(#PCDATA)> < !ELEMENT email(#PCDATA)> < !ELEMENT rubrique(titre,contenu)> < !ELEMNET contenu(#PCDATA)> < !ELEMNT titre(#PCDATA)> 4 Exo2 : Q1 ; fichiers XML <personnel> <person Note= "salut" contr = "true" salary="35000"> <name> <family>wallace</family> <given>bob</given> </name> <email>fasa44227@gmail.com</email> <link manger ="C.tuttle"/> </person> <person Note ="Hello" contr= "false" salary="56000"> <name> <family>tutlle</family> <given>claire</given> </name> <email> moma17@gmail.com</email> 5 <link> manger="B_wallice"/> </person> </personnel> Q2 ; fichiers XML < ?xml version= "1 ,0" encoding ="utf-8 " ?> <xsd :schéma xmlns :xsd="http://www.wzoorg/2001/xml schéma"> <xsd :élement name="personnel"> <xsd :complexType> <xsd :séquence> <xsd :element name "person"min="1 " max"unbounded"> <xsd :complexType> <xsd :séquence> <xsd :element neme="to names" type="xsd :string" /> 6 <xsd :element name="eamil" type="xsd :string"/> <xsd :element name="link"type="xsd :int"/> <xsd :element name="url"type=xsd :int/> <xsd :complexType> <Xsd :séquence> <xsd :element name ="family" type=xsd :string/> <xsd :element name="given"type=xsd :string /> </xsd :séquence> < /xsd :complexType> </xsd :element> </xsd :séquence> </xsd :complexType> </xsd :élement> </xsd :complexType> Exo 03: Q1: 7 <?xml version="1.0" encoding="UTF-8"?> <x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transfor m"> <xsl:output method="html" /> <xsl:template match="personne"> <html> <head> </head> <body > <table align="center" border = "6"> <tr bgcolor="Red"> <th> Nom </th> <th> Capitale </th> <th> monnaie </th> </tr> <xsl:for-eachselect="Pays"> <tr> <td> <xsl:value-of select="nom"/> </td> <td> <xsl:value-ofselect="Capitale "/> </td> <td> <xsl:value-of select ="monnaie"/> </td> </xsl:for-each> </table> </body> </html> </xsl:template> </xsl:stylesheet> Q2: <?xml version="1.0" encoding="UTF-8"?> <xsd: schéma xmlns:xsd = "http://www.w3.org/1999/XSL/Transform"> 8 <xsd:element name "pays"> <xsd:complextype> <xsd:sequence> <xsd:element name = "nom"type= "xsd:"string"/> <xsd:element name = "capitale"type="string"> <xsd:element name = "monnaie" type = "string"/> </xsd:sequence> </xsd: complextype > </xsd: schema> ………………… 9 uploads/Science et Technologie/ devoir - 2022-12-27T110859.904.pdf
-
11
-
0
-
0
Licence et utilisation
Gratuit pour un usage personnel Attribution requise- Détails
- Publié le Apv 20, 2022
- Catégorie Science & technolo...
- Langue French
- Taille du fichier 0.0702MB